Transaction 156cdd959f5f8f8844a526660e721072368b919813af4f7ed0239dd63702abbf
1 Input
1 Output
-
156cdd959f5f8f8844a526660e721072368b919813af4f7ed0239dd63702abbf:0
- value
- 25000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 37ffba46e703cfb6332b7a016baa765a1076f1d0 OP_EQUAL
- address
- 36o7SMzEUEvfXC4PjBsuQSJtiiqn9VzLbU